24y
Health on MSN5 Benefits of Amla (Indian Gooseberry), Plus Facts and NutritionMedically reviewed by Simone Harounian, MS Amla, also known as Indian gooseberry (Phyllanthus emblica), is a fruit tree native to India and Southeast Asia. The berries from the tree have been used in ...
Amla, also known as Indian gooseberry (Phyllanthus emblica), is a fruit tree native to India and Southeast Asia. The berries from the tree have been used in traditional medicine and may have 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results